Hello, I am new to Forums but looking for some help. I currently have Classe’ sigma series Pre-amp, a 5 channel Sigma series amp for my 2 B&W 804 D3 towers(bi-amped) and matching center channel and a 2 channel Sigma series for my rear speakers (804 D4)
The other day I turned my system on(have all three amps can bussed) wasn’t really paying attention at first, but soon noticed my rear speakers weren’t playing. Looked at the 2 channel amp and there was no power light or anything. Thought it popped the fuse( which I know means there is a deeper issue) ordered some new fuses, replaced the fuse(I did not disconnect any of the speaker cables) turned the system on, it fired up but then all of a sudden it sounded like firecrackers were going off in my living room. I shut the system off, unplugged it and now I am scared to even touch it. Did I fry my system? Does anyone know or experienced this before? PLEASE HELP. Thank you in advance
